7. Abbreviations and acronyms

  • MRP: project risk management

  • PMR: risk (and opportunity) management plan

  • HSE: health, safety, environment

  • SdF (FMDS): operating safety (reliability, maintainability, availability, safety)

  • PMO: Project Management Office

  • MOE: project manager

  • MOA: project owner

  • SWOT: Strengths, Weaknesses, Opportunities and Threats; Mapping a situation according to two complementary logics: internal (S & W) and external (O & T).

  • PEST: Political, Economical, Social, Technical; Mapping of an investment situation along four classic axes

  • TOC: Theory of Constraints
